How can I route the entire device traffic through AG? Currently, I believe only a few browsers are filtered as seen in the 'List of Filtered Apps' section. Is there a way through which ALL of the device traffic (incoming & outgoing) is routed through AG so that it can filter ads, trackers, etc. not just in few programs but all of them? I know this is possible in AG for Android (via a VPN/Proxy) but is it possible in AG for Windows too?

That's what we're going to do in AG v8.0. For now, unfortunately, the only way is to add apps in the network settings.
